White Chocolate Chip Protein Cookies

Ingredients

½ cup coconut flour
3 scoops NLA Her Whey Vanilla Cupcake Protein Powder
1 Tbsp. oat flour
¼ cup white chocolate chips
¼ cup honey
1 Tbsp. almond milk
1 tsp. baking powder
1 tsp. vanilla flavoring
1 egg
Chopped pecans

Directions

  1. Preheat oven to 350 degrees F and coat a cookie sheet with non-stick cooking spray.
  2. In a large bowl, combine all cookie ingredients – except white chocolate chips and pecans – and stir into a thick dough.
  3. Add white chocolate chips and chopped pecans.
  4. Form dough into balls. Note: it will be sticky, but you can add more flour if it’s too sticky to work with.
  5. Place cookie dough balls on baking sheet and bake 8-10 minutes, or until golden.
  6. Flatten the cookies just a bit, if desired and eat as soon as you can!
